Contributions due to the longitudinal virtual photon in the semi-inclusive ep collision at HERA
Urszula Jezuita-Dabrowska (Institute of Theoretical Physics, Warsaw University)🇵🇱
Abstract
The importance of contributions due to the longitudinally polarised virtual photon and the longitudinal-transverse interference term, in the unpolarised ep collisions is discussed. The numerical calculations for the Compton process, e p --> e gamma X, at the HERA collider were performed in the Born approximation. The various distributions in the ep centre-of-mass and Breit frames are presented. These cross sections are dominated by the transversely polarised intermediate photon, even for large values of its virtuality.
